The Type 2 Diabetes Score in 97355, Lebanon, Oregon is 16 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

84.62 percent of the population in 97355 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 60.44 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 7.74 percent of the residents in 97355 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.46 members with about 2.24 cars available per household.

An estimate of 93.80 percent of the residents in 97355 has some form of health insurance. 43.41 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 66.97 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 97355 would have to travel an average of 1.35 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Samaritan Lebanon Community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 97355, Lebanon, Oregon.

As of , an estimate of 31,643 residents live in 97355 with a median age of 42.0 years. 20.76 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 20.78 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 37.05 percent of the residents in 97355 is currently married, and 21.49 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 97355 is $5,761.58.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 97355 is approximately $1,116. The median household spends about 19.37 percent of their income on housing.

Type 2 Diabetes is a chronic condition characterized by high levels of blood sugar resulting from the body's ineffective use of insulin. It is a serious health concern that requires ongoing management and care. Access to healthcare providers, regular check-ups, and medication are essential for individuals living with Type 2 Diabetes.
